As a lot of you know Faith has eaten several cans of "recalled" nutro natural choice canned puppy food. On recommendation from the ontario veterinary association I decided to take her into the vet tonight and get a blood collection taken.. She needed to get her kidney functioning tested to ensure that she was not affected by tainted food. The vet consultation was $63 - the blood collection was $25 and the kidney test was $80. So we're looking at $180 just for their mistake!
